Product Details: Starfire WR All-Season Tire

  • Size: 245/45R18 96W
  • Section Width: 245 millimeters
  • Load Capacity: 1565 pounds
  • Tread Type: Asymmetrical
  • Tread Depth: 10.5 32nds
  • Maximum Pressure: 51 PSI
  • Ply Rating: 12-Ply
  • Rim Size: 18 inches

Performance in Different Weather Conditions

One of the main reasons drivers gravitate toward the Starfire WR All-Season Tire is its versatility. The asymmetrical tread design helps provide great traction whether the road is wet or dry. Four wide circumferential grooves enhance hydroplaning resistance, making wet-weather driving much safer.

While it can handle light snow, it’s important to note that it might struggle in more severe winter conditions. However, for drivers who experience moderate winters or live in areas where snow isn’t as frequent, this tire is a solid choice.

Durability and Tread Wear

Drivers love the long-lasting durability of these tires. With an advanced 5-rib asymmetric tread pattern, the Starfire WR tire wears evenly, which means you won’t have to worry about uneven patches developing over time. This also ensures that the tires will last longer, saving you money in the long run.

Although it’s marketed as an all-season tire, its strongest performance is on dry and wet roads. If you primarily drive in regions with heavy snowfall, it may be worth considering a winter-specific tire during the coldest months.

How long do Starfire WR All-Season Tires last?

Starfire WR All-Season Tires are designed with even tread wear, offering a long lifespan. Drivers can expect these tires to last for around 40,000 miles, depending on driving habits and road conditions. Regular tire rotations will help extend their life.

Are Starfire WR All-Season Tires good for winter?

Starfire WR All-Season Tires perform well in light snow but may struggle in heavy winter conditions. For areas with frequent snowstorms, switching to dedicated winter tires would be advisable for better safety and handling.
